Abstract: A method for continuously manufacturing aerosol generating articles (1) comprises: (i) providing a continuous web (34) of an aerosol generating substrate (10), the continuous web (34) including a substantially flat surface having a centre line (18); (ii) applying at least one susceptor patch (28) to the substantially flat surface substantially along the centre line (18) to leave an exposed region (90) of the continuous web (34) of aerosol generating substrate (10) on each side of the at least one susceptor patch (28); (iii) cutting the exposed regions (90) of the continuous web (34) of aerosol generating substrate (10) to form a plurality of aerosol generating strips (15, 16) on each side of the at least one susceptor patch (28); and (iv) forming the plurality of aerosol generating strips (15, 16) and the at least one susceptor patch (28) into a continuous rod (88).

Abstract: The invention relates to an aerosol-generating device. The aerosol¬ generating device comprises at least two heating arrangements (12). Each heating arrangement (12) comprises a heating coil (32), a first contact (34), a second contact (36) and a third contact (38). The first contact (34) is arranged contacting a distal end of the heating coil (32). The second contact (36) is arranged contacting a proximal end of the heating coil. The third contact (38) is arranged contacting the heating coil (32) between the first contact (34) and the second contact (36). The aerosol generating device further comprises a sliding arrangement (28). The heating coils (32) of the heating arrangements (12) are arranged side by side parallel to a longitudinal axis of the aerosol-generating device. The sliding arrangement (28) is arranged adjacent the heating coils (32) and configured to slide parallel to the longitudinal axis of the aerosol-generating device and parallel to the heating coils (32). The third contacts (38) of the heating arrangements (12) are mounted on the sliding arrangement (28). An electrical contact point between each third contact (38) and each respective heating coil (32) is adaptable by sliding the sliding arrangement (28). The invention further relates to a system comprising an aerosol-generating device and an aerosol-generating article comprising aerosol-forming substrate.

Abstract: A method of manufacturing a consumable for use in a non- combustible aerosol provision device which comprises providing a susceptor arrangement (1) comprising first and second susceptor portions (2) and a connector (3) joining the first and second susceptor portions to each other, wherein the first and second susceptor portions are spaced apart from each other by the connector. The method further comprises forming an assembly comprising the susceptor arrangement and aerosol-generating material and dividing the assembly, wherein the dividing comprises dividing the connector and the aerosol-generating material. According to the present disclosure, there is also provided a susceptor arrangement for use in a method of manufacturing a consumable for use with a non- combustible aerosol provision device, an assembly for use in a method of manufacturing a consumable, a consumable for use with a non-combustible aerosol provision device, and non-combustible aerosol provision system.

Abstract: An aerosol delivery device and a substrate tablet for use with an inductively-heated aerosol delivery device are provided. The aerosol delivery device comprises a control body having a housing, a mouthpiece portion located proximate the housing, a resonant transmitter located in the control body, a control component configured to drive the resonant transmitter, and a substrate tablet receivable in the device. The substrate tablet may comprise a granular substrate material and a susceptor component, the substrate material and the susceptor component may be configured to be formed together, and the susceptor component may be configured to be heated by the resonant transmitter.
